Twins fans will see a familiar face on the mound for the Blue Jays today in Game 2 of the American League wild-card series at Target Field.
Jóse Berríos, who was with the Twins for the first 5½ seasons of his major league career in Minnesota and was a two-time All-Star, was traded to the Jays at the 2021 deadline. He signed a long-term deal in Toronto, and will try to keep them from being eliminated in the best-of-three series at 3:38 p.m.
The Twins won the opener on Tuesday 3-1 as Royce Lewis belted a pair of home runs.
Berrios (11-12, 3.65 ERA) faces Twins righthander Sonny Gray (8-8, 2.79).
